Strategic Alliances and Technical Strengths: A Foundation for Growth
Arras's recent drilling results at the Berezski North Target—276 meters grading 0.58% CuEq, including 104 meters at 1.14% CuEq—highlight the company's technical prowess in identifying and developing deep-dormant mineralization[1]. These intercepts, part of a broader 1,700-square-kilometer exploration program in Kazakhstan's Pavlodar region, suggest the presence of a large, underexplored porphyry system. The company's collaboration with Teck Resources LimitedTECK--, which has committed $5 million to geological exploration through 2025, further bolsters its ability to advance these projects[4]. Such partnerships are critical in a sector where upfront capital costs and geopolitical risks often deter smaller players.
The Beskauga Project, in particular, stands out as a flagship asset. Located in a region with historical copper production but minimal modern exploration, Beskauga's potential to host a world-class deposit aligns with global demand for copper—a metal now dubbed the “new oil” due to its role in renewable energy infrastructure[3]. Arras's leadership team, seasoned in both exploration and mine development, has demonstrated a disciplined approach to capital allocation, ensuring that resources are directed toward high-impact targets[1].
Sector Tailwinds: Inflation, Geopolitics, and the Green Transition
The broader precious metals sector is experiencing a perfect storm of demand drivers. Gold, long a safe-haven asset, has seen its price surge alongside the NYSE Arca Gold Miners Index, which has gained over 50% year-to-date in 2025—outpacing gold bullion's 25.35% rise[3]. Central banks' ongoing diversification away from U.S. dollar reserves and the proliferation of gold-backed ETFs post-2024 regulatory changes have further solidified its appeal[4]. For Arras, this environment creates a favorable backdrop for its gold-focused projects, which could benefit from rising prices and increased investor appetite for junior miners with high-growth potential.
Silver, meanwhile, is being propelled by its dual role as an industrial and investment metal. With electric vehicles (EVs) requiring 25–50 grams of silver per unit and solar panels consuming 20 grams per module, the metal's demand is set to outpace supply in the coming decade[1]. Arras's exploration in Kazakhstan—a country with limited silver production but significant polymetallic potential—positions it to tap into this growing market.
